Understanding EOT Crane Manufacturers in Pune Types and Variations
Type Name | Key Distinguishing Features | Primary B2B Applications | Brief Pros & Cons for Buyers |
---|---|---|---|
Single Girder EOT Crane | Lightweight design, cost-effective, suitable for light loads | Warehousing, assembly lines | Pros: Lower cost, easier installation. Cons: Limited load capacity. |
Double Girder EOT Crane | Robust construction, higher load capacity, versatile | Heavy manufacturing, steel plants | Pros: Greater lifting capacity, stability. Cons: Higher cost, requires more space. |
Cantilever EOT Crane | Extended reach, ideal for outdoor applications | Construction sites, shipyards | Pros: Flexibility in operation, increased workspace. Cons: More complex installation. |
Explosion-Proof EOT Crane | Designed for hazardous environments, safety features | Chemical plants, oil refineries | Pros: Enhanced safety, compliance with regulations. Cons: Higher initial investment, specialized maintenance. |
Automated EOT Crane | Integrated with smart technology for remote operations | Warehousing, logistics facilities | Pros: Increased efficiency, reduced labor costs. Cons: Higher upfront costs, requires technical expertise. |
What Are the Key Characteristics of Single Girder EOT Cranes?
Single Girder EOT Cranes are characterized by their lightweight design and cost-effectiveness, making them an attractive option for businesses that require lifting solutions for lighter loads. Typically used in warehousing and assembly lines, these cranes are easier to install and require less structural support. B2B buyers should consider their operational needs, as these cranes may not be suitable for heavy lifting tasks but offer an economical solution for smaller operations.
How Do Double Girder EOT Cranes Stand Out?
Double Girder EOT Cranes feature a robust construction that allows for a higher load capacity, making them ideal for heavy manufacturing and steel plants. Their design provides greater stability and can accommodate larger and heavier loads compared to single girder models. Buyers looking for reliability and strength in lifting equipment should evaluate the operational demands of their facility, as the higher cost and space requirements of double girder cranes may be justified by their performance capabilities.
What Makes Cantilever EOT Cranes Suitable for Outdoor Applications?
Cantilever EOT Cranes are designed with an extended reach, making them particularly effective for outdoor applications such as construction sites and shipyards. Their flexibility allows for operation in areas where traditional cranes may not be practical. Buyers should assess the complexity of installation and potential operational challenges, as these cranes can require more sophisticated setups than standard models.
Why Choose Explosion-Proof EOT Cranes for Hazardous Environments?
Explosion-Proof EOT Cranes are specifically engineered for use in hazardous environments, such as chemical plants and oil refineries, featuring enhanced safety measures to comply with strict regulations. While they provide significant safety benefits, these cranes come with a higher initial investment and may require specialized maintenance. B2B buyers must weigh the importance of safety and compliance against the upfront costs to determine if this type of crane aligns with their operational needs.
How Do Automated EOT Cranes Improve Efficiency in Logistics?
Automated EOT Cranes incorporate smart technology that allows for remote operations, making them a highly efficient choice for warehousing and logistics facilities. These cranes can significantly reduce labor costs and improve operational efficiency, but they come with higher upfront costs and may require technical expertise for installation and maintenance. B2B buyers should consider their long-term operational strategy and the potential return on investment when evaluating automated solutions.

In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for EOT Crane Manufacturers in Pune
What Are the Main Stages of the Manufacturing Process for EOT Cranes?
The manufacturing process for Electric Overhead Traveling (EOT) cranes involves several critical stages that ensure the final product meets the required specifications for strength, safety, and reliability. Understanding these stages is essential for international B2B buyers looking to source high-quality cranes from Pune.
-
Material Preparation
This initial stage involves selecting high-grade materials such as structural steel and alloy components. The materials are thoroughly inspected for quality and compliance with international standards. Suppliers often utilize advanced technology for cutting and shaping, ensuring precise dimensions that facilitate further processing. -
Forming Techniques
Various forming techniques, such as welding, bending, and machining, are employed to create the structural components of the crane. Welding is particularly critical, as it connects various parts, ensuring structural integrity. Manufacturers in Pune often use automated welding systems to enhance precision and reduce human error. -
Assembly Process
The assembly of EOT cranes is a meticulous process where components like the hoist, trolley, and runway beams are integrated. Skilled technicians follow detailed assembly instructions and use specialized tools to ensure that each component is correctly fitted and aligned. This phase is crucial for the crane’s operational efficiency. -
Finishing Touches
After assembly, the crane undergoes finishing processes, including surface treatment, painting, and protective coatings. These steps not only enhance the aesthetic appeal but also provide corrosion resistance, which is vital for cranes operating in various environments, including humid or corrosive atmospheres.

What Are the Key Quality Control Checkpoints in EOT Crane Manufacturing?
Effective quality control (QC) is essential to ensure that each EOT crane meets the required specifications. Here are the key QC checkpoints that international buyers should be aware of:
-
Incoming Quality Control (IQC)
This initial checkpoint involves inspecting raw materials and components upon arrival at the manufacturing facility. Suppliers perform visual inspections and material tests to verify compliance with specifications and standards. -
In-Process Quality Control (IPQC)
During the manufacturing process, regular inspections and testing are conducted to ensure that each stage adheres to established quality standards. This includes monitoring welding quality, dimensional accuracy, and component alignment. -
Final Quality Control (FQC)
The final inspection occurs after the crane assembly is complete. This thorough examination involves functional testing, load testing, and safety checks to confirm that the crane operates correctly and meets safety regulations.
What Testing Methods Are Commonly Used for EOT Cranes?
Testing is a crucial component of the quality assurance process for EOT cranes. Various methods are employed to ensure that the cranes meet both performance and safety standards:
-
Load Testing
This involves subjecting the crane to its maximum rated load to ensure it can operate safely under extreme conditions. Load testing is typically performed in accordance with industry standards and is often witnessed by third-party inspectors. -
Non-Destructive Testing (NDT)
Techniques such as ultrasonic testing, magnetic particle testing, and dye penetrant testing are used to identify any internal or surface defects in welded joints and structural components without damaging the parts. -
Functional Testing
This testing phase assesses the crane’s operational capabilities, including its lifting speed, hoisting mechanisms, and control functions. Functional tests simulate real-world operating conditions to verify performance.

Comprehensive Cost and Pricing Analysis for EOT Crane Manufacturers in Pune Sourcing
What Are the Key Cost Components for EOT Cranes Manufactured in Pune?
When sourcing EOT cranes from Pune, understanding the cost structure is crucial for international buyers. The primary components that contribute to the pricing of EOT cranes include:
- Materials: The choice of materials significantly impacts costs. High-quality steel and specialized components for hoisting and movement can increase expenses but also enhance durability and performance.
- Labor: Skilled labor in Pune is relatively cost-effective, but wages may vary based on expertise and experience. Labor costs can also fluctuate based on local labor laws and demand.
- Manufacturing Overhead: This encompasses utilities, rent, and equipment depreciation. Pune’s industrial ecosystem offers competitive overhead costs, but fluctuations in energy prices can affect total expenses.
- Tooling: The initial investment in tooling can be substantial, particularly for customized cranes. Efficient tooling processes can lead to cost savings in the long run.
- Quality Control (QC): Investing in robust QC processes is essential to ensure product reliability and compliance with international standards, which can add to the overall cost.
- Logistics: Shipping and handling costs must be factored in, especially when exporting to regions like Africa, South America, or Europe. Distance, shipping method, and tariffs can influence these costs.
- Margin: Manufacturers typically add a profit margin based on market conditions, competition, and perceived value.
How Do Price Influencers Affect EOT Crane Sourcing from Pune?
Several factors can significantly influence the pricing of EOT cranes:
- Volume and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): Ordering in bulk can lead to substantial discounts. Understanding the manufacturer’s MOQ can help buyers negotiate better pricing.
- Specifications and Customization: Custom cranes tailored to specific operational needs will generally incur higher costs due to the additional design and manufacturing efforts.
- Material Quality and Certifications: Cranes that meet international quality standards (ISO, CE, etc.) may have higher upfront costs but provide better long-term value through enhanced safety and performance.
- Supplier Factors: The reputation and reliability of the manufacturer can affect pricing. Established suppliers may charge a premium for their experience and quality assurance.
- Incoterms: The terms of shipment (e.g., FOB, CIF) impact overall costs. Buyers should be clear on which costs they are responsible for to avoid unexpected expenses.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for EOT Crane Manufacturers in Pune
What Are the Essential Technical Properties of EOT Cranes?
When considering the procurement of EOT (Electric Overhead Traveling) cranes, international B2B buyers must understand the critical technical specifications that define the quality and performance of these machines. Here are key properties to consider:
-
Load Capacity
Load capacity refers to the maximum weight that the crane can lift safely. This specification is crucial for buyers as it directly impacts the crane’s usability in various applications. Understanding load capacity helps in selecting the right crane for specific operational needs, ensuring efficiency and safety in material handling. -
Span Length
The span length is the distance between the crane’s support structures. A well-defined span is essential for maximizing operational space and ensuring that the crane can cover the required area without limitations. Buyers should consider their facility layout when evaluating span options to ensure compatibility. -
Material Grade
The material grade indicates the quality and durability of the crane components, including the frame, hoist, and trolley. Common materials include high-strength steel, which offers enhanced resistance to wear and stress. Understanding material specifications is vital for buyers to ensure long-term reliability and minimize maintenance costs. -
Hoisting Speed
Hoisting speed refers to how quickly the crane can lift and lower loads. This property affects productivity levels and can vary based on the application. Buyers should assess the required hoisting speed to match their operational workflow, particularly in industries with high throughput demands. -
Power Supply Type
EOT cranes can operate on different power supply systems, such as three-phase AC or DC power. The choice of power supply impacts the crane’s operational efficiency and compatibility with existing infrastructure. Buyers need to consider their facility’s electrical setup when selecting a crane to avoid additional costs for modifications.
What Are Common Trade Terms Used in EOT Crane Procurement?
Understanding industry jargon is essential for navigating the procurement process effectively. Here are some key terms relevant to EOT crane transactions:
-
O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er)
An OEM is a company that produces components that may be marketed by another manufacturer. In the context of EOT cranes, buyers often work directly with OEMs to ensure they receive high-quality parts and service. Knowing the OEM’s reputation can significantly influence the reliability of the cranes procured. -
M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ity)
MOQ refers to the smallest number of units a supplier is willing to sell. This term is particularly important for international buyers who may need to assess whether they can meet the MOQ requirements without overextending their budget or storage capacity. -
RFQ (Request for Quotation)
An RFQ is a document used by buyers to solicit price quotes from suppliers for specific products or services. For EOT cranes, providing detailed specifications in an RFQ can lead to more accurate and competitive pricing from manufacturers in Pune. -
Incoterms (International Commercial Terms)
Incoterms are a set of predefined international sales terms that clarify the responsibilities of buyers and sellers regarding shipping, insurance, and tariffs. Familiarity with Incoterms is crucial for international transactions, as they can significantly affect cost structures and logistics planning. -
Lead Time
Lead time refers to the period between placing an order and receiving the product. Understanding lead times is essential for B2B buyers to plan their operations and manage project timelines effectively. Delays in lead time can result in increased costs or missed deadlines.
